A »When seeking high-performance coatings for commercial printing inks within the United Kingdom, several established manufacturers offer specialized products designed to enhance durability, gloss, scratch resistance, and chemical stability across various printing processes, including lithographic, flexographic, gravure, and digital applications. Among the most prominent is Sun Chemical, a global leader with significant UK manufacturing and technical support operations; their portfolio includes energy-curable, water-based, and solvent-based coatings such as overprint varnishes and primers that meet rigorous industry standards for speed, adhesion, and environmental compliance, particularly under their Solaris and UltraCure brands. Similarly, Flint Group maintains a strong UK presence and supplies a comprehensive range of high-performance coatings, including their ECO-TEC line of water-based and UV-curable overprint varnishes, which are formulated to deliver exceptional rub resistance and gloss levels while aligning with sustainable packaging initiatives. Another key player is Siegwerk, which operates a UK subsidiary and offers advanced coating solutions such as the SICURA series for UV and LED curing, providing enhanced barrier properties and printability for demanding commercial applications. For niche, high-specification requirements, UK-based Touchstone Coatings specializes in bespoke coatings for digital and offset printing, including anti-scuff, matte, and high-gloss finishes that can be custom-engineered to meet exacting customer parameters. Additionally, Fujifilm Sericol, with UK manufacturing and R&D facilities, provides a wide array of UV and water-based coatings tailored for screen and digital printing, noted for their excellent flexibility and adhesion on challenging substrates. Other notable suppliers include AkzoNobel, whose coatings for printing inks often focus on corrosion resistance and metal decoration applications, and Croda International, which supplies additives and specialty coatings that enhance performance properties such as slip, gloss, and block resistance. It is also worth mentioning that smaller, specialized UK manufacturers like Contract Coatings Ltd. and Premier Coatings offer custom formulation services for commercial printers seeking differentiated performance metrics such as high-temperature resistance or food-safe compliance. In sum, the UK market for high-performance printing ink coatings is robust, with both multinational corporations and local specialists providing a diverse array of technologies—from UV-curable and water-based systems to solvent-based and energy-curable innovations—to meet the evolving demands of the commercial printing sector, with a growing emphasis on sustainability, reduced VOC emissions, and compatibility with high-speed press operations.
